MARION, OH (MARION COUNTY NOW)—The 36th annual Ohio Valley Christmas Craft Show will be held Sunday, Nov. 2, 2025, at the Marion County Fairgrounds Coliseum.

The long-running event, one of the largest in the Marion area, will feature more than 100 craft spaces under one roof. The one-day show will run from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m.

Exhibitors from across Ohio are expected to attend, offering a wide array of one-of-a-kind, handcrafted holiday items. Shoppers can browse unique gifts and decor, including wreaths, wooden sleighs, hot cocoa bombs, hand-woven baskets, handmade cutting boards, jewelry, primitive and rustic home decor, dolls, and floral arrangements. The show will also feature many direct sales companies with Christmas decorating ideas and gifts.

Admission to the craft show is $1, with free parking available on the Marion County Fairgrounds.
